This volume is dedicated to recent researches for the development of innovative telecommunication systems, with particular focus on the propagation aspects and radiating systems design.

The book is divided into two sections:

Section 1, devoted to the illustration of advanced results in terms of microwave propagation at high operating frequencies, and

Section 2, illustrating new electromagnetic concepts and applications.
